zed-industries / create-gpui-app

CRA-style tool for creating new gpui apps
MIT License
130 stars 8 forks source link

Refactor code to enable modular templates #8

Closed swaptr closed 1 month ago

swaptr commented 2 months ago

This PR aims to refactor the code base into a better dx while adding templates and extending the cli.

cla-bot[bot] commented 2 months ago

We require contributors to sign our Contributor License Agreement, and we don't have @swaptr on file. You can sign our CLA at https://zed.dev/cla. Once you've signed, post a comment here that says '@cla-bot check'.

cla-bot[bot] commented 2 months ago

We require contributors to sign our Contributor License Agreement, and we don't have @swaptr on file. You can sign our CLA at https://zed.dev/cla. Once you've signed, post a comment here that says '@cla-bot check'.

swaptr commented 2 months ago

@cla-bot check

cla-bot[bot] commented 2 months ago

The cla-bot has been summoned, and re-checked this pull request!

swaptr commented 2 months ago

@iamnbutler Any feedback on this approach? I plan to extend this tool with more templates and would appreciate your input.

iamnbutler commented 1 month ago

Hey sorry! I'll take a look and get this merged today!

iamnbutler commented 1 month ago

LGTM – Feel free to reach out to me on our discord if I don't see any PRs, or chat about this in our #gpui channel there :)

Thanks for contributing!